Block

#18,134,179
Block Number
18,134,179 @ 03/31/2024, 07:17:10
Status
Finalized
ID
0x0114b4a39b28e0d2ae3ced59605d37276e7abda405a3c309296fc3e4afe6fc6b
Transactions
Gas Used
509206/30000000 (1.70% Used)
Total Score
1,767,719,092 (+98)
Rewards
1.61 VTHO